In Arkansas, DDS stands for the Division of Developmental Services. This division oversees various programs and services for individuals with developmental disabilities, ensuring they receive necessary supports. The PASSE program, or Provider-Led Arkansas Shared Savings Entity, is an initiative that enhances support for individuals with developmental disabilities. It offers coordinated care and resources aimed at improving health outcomes and stability for participants.
